My friend and I traveled to Salem for a brief overnight trip. We could not recommend the Daniels house more. We were assigned to the Great Room which was huge. We also were given access to the private driveway for parking (perhaps that’s the parking space that goes with the great room). The room and bathroom were both very generous in size. The king sized bed was so comfortable we slept so well. When we stayed in Salem it was super hot/humid and they had the room at a wonderful temp upon our arrival. The Inn was also very quiet. I expected squeaky floors with it being an holder home and that wasn’t an issue either. I also loved their check-in, check- out online system. It’s personable, informative, and helpful. We also feel like they vet their guests a bit and every gets a personal code to access the building- it felt very safe to us as well. The breakfast was more like a hotel breakfast but it was perfect. Water, OJ, self serve coffee and house teas, assorted breads, PB and jelly, cream cheese, hard boiled eggs, yogurt, fruit, cereal etc. they also asked if we had any preferences (allergies etc) prior to our stay. We also met the manager and he was so kind and helpful! Would highly recommend and stay there again.

Clean, comfortable, historic stay
Beautiful historical home. It was a very easy no contact check in process which was explained thoroughly by email prior to arriving. The vouchers we were given for breakfast were for a restaurant with extremely good food. Our room was very clean and they provided bottled water, towels, and toiletries in the room. This was our first stay at a bed and breakfast so we weren’t quite sure what to expect but we had a great time. We didn’t realize the only way to see the rest of the home is to book a tour, so be sure to do that if you want to see more than just your room and bathroom. Also while it is stated online, be aware that all 3rd floor rooms share a bathroom, this was the only thing I didn’t care for but that being said, we were aware of that when we booked it so we knew what we were signing up for. Excellent location near all the tourist stops but far enough off the path it’s nice and quiet. All in all a great stay, comfortable and clean and we would stay again for sure.
